Output d576d0cdceb788397b34afb01b3ee3ad97f5732f022959b0320dd76320d21b07:3

value
104251
script pubkey
OP_0 OP_PUSHBYTES_20 9e3cc973b063e700b6dbad22d8e24149c4b9d2a0
address
bc1qnc7vjuasv0nspdkm453d3cjpf8ztn54qrtr2y3
transaction
d576d0cdceb788397b34afb01b3ee3ad97f5732f022959b0320dd76320d21b07
confirmations
150164
spent
true